The Pre-Purchase Inspection Process
At Clark Automotive, a pre-purchase vehicle inspection involves an ASE-certified mechanic that will look for any defects or problems with the vehicle that you intend to buy. The inspector will look for mechanical and exterior defects. An inspection may include taking the car for a test drive. Inspectors will additionally look for irregularities, damage underneath the vehicle, and any leaks. A thorough inspection includes an examination of all safety equipment and the engine.

What You Need To Know
In most cases, pre-inspections performed by reputable dealerships are trustworthy. Most dealers will not put a used car or truck on their lot without a thorough inspection and some maintenance work already performed. Sometimes it’s even backed by a warranty. Still, it never hurts to get a second opinion. When dealing with a private seller, it is especially recommended that you seek an inspection by an expert auto repair shop like Clark Automotive.
